  • Acosta is a sales and marketing company with a primary focus in retail. Highlight your retail experiences. Are you a fantastic merchandiser? Can you complete resets like a pro? Are you a quick counter who can accurately complete audits? The recruiters want to hear stuff like that. They also like strong leadership skills and people who are self starters, since most of the company's work is done through remote workers. Also, if you've ever been in retail management, even if you were a shift leader at McDonald's 10 years ago, throw it out there. Most of the people I've worked with are former retail supervisors. I hope this helps anyone looking to interview. Good luck!

  • Experience in the requested job is helpful, but often it's just being in the right place at the right time. Monitor the website very often fir new jobs, although some are internal hires that still must be posted. Recruiters call first, but they're not company employees & only have limited company knowledge. Large turnover, so jobs should come up often enough. Be careful about taking a job driving long distances due to the reimbursement policy. Good luck!
